The motion would largely amount to a symbolic gesture, but an important one as private sector and low\u002Dincome workers bear the brunt of COVID\u0027s economic fallout

Members of both the House of Commons and Senate receive automatic pay raises equal to inflation every year. MPs make annual salaries of $182,600, not including additional payments for special positions like prime minister or opposition leader. Senators make a base salary of $157,600.

“For people who hold public office, when you see people struggling around you it is hard to see, it’s hard to wrap your head around,” Moncion said. “We keep hearing all the time that we’re all in this together,” he said. “Well, not really if the government isn’t making any sacrifices while other people are losing their businesses and losing their jobs.”Article content continuedGovernment leaders in a number of other countries have already cut their own salaries, often by more sizeable amounts than those recommended in the Moncion motion.
